Howdy from Ky!
I just finished my '66 Chevelle and thought I'd send you some pics for the Members rides section. This is a car I have been trying to buy from a friend of mine who bought it out of New Mexico in the early 2000's. It is a total nut and bolt restoration. It was started on Aug. 17,2010 and pretty much finished on Feb.2,2013. The bottom and frame of this car had zero pitting on it. You can see all the little factory stampings on it. Calif. built original sheet metal, factory 4-sp, bucket seat, originally Marina blue FF code with bright blue interior 731 code. I had to paint it black cause I'm a black freak when it comes to cars. I found a '65 Corvette 327/365 motor for it with a Muncie M-20 and a 12 bolt 355 posi rear. Nothing sounds better than a small block solid lifter Chevy motor. You won't believe this but I bought the complete, carb to oil pan, rebuilt Corvette 327/365 motor from a guy in California, got it home had the VIN number run and found the original car for this engine 30 miles from my house!!! I tried to mate it back up with the car but he was not interested in it. I found the build sheet for the car in it but no other paperwork.
